Lynne Irene Spears (née Bridges; born 1955) is an American author and the mother of pop singer Britney Spears and teen actress Jamie Lynn Spears.
Spears was born in McComb, Mississippi. Her mother, Lilian Irene Portell (1924–1993), was a native of Hendon, London. Her father, Barney O'Field Bridges (1919–1978), was an American G.I.. In 1945, her parents met and married in Hendon. Her maternal great-grandfather, Edward Portelli, was Maltese and emigrated to England, where he married Alice Taylor. Spears has an older brother, Barry "Sonny" Bridges (born 1951), and had an older sister, Sandra Bridges Covington (1947–2007), who died of ovarian cancer.
In 1975, she married James "Jamie" Spears. They were divorced by 2002 and reconciled in 2010. Jamie and Lynne Spears have three children: son Bryan James (born 1977) and daughters Britney Jean (born 1981) and Jamie Lynn Marie (born 1991).
